The iPhone Dev Team announces on Thursday the plan to release their PwnageTool 2.0, Not long after Apple released the iPhone 2.0 firmware. The group has  published a video of the soon to be released PwnageTool 2.0 that makes it really easy to unlock and jailbreak with the new firmware. The video demonstrates an iPhone running firmware version 2.0 with a working official App Store as well as Cydia. While it seems to be a legitimate video, the Dev Team has not announced when they would release the PwnageTool for anyone to use. According to the team, “We’ve added lots of new features, including 2.0 support, spotlight file indexing of .ipsws, canned websearches, installer custom configuration, custom root partitions and various other things that you’ll see on the release.
